Nearly 20 local artists spent the day at Bridge Gardens on July 6. Inspired by the colorful flowers and landscape, they created a body of work that will be on display — and for sale — at our next Bridge Gardens Member’s Only Music Night on July 29th. A portion of the proceeds from the sale of any of these paintings or photographs will be donated to the Peconic Land Trust in support of Bridge Gardens.

The Wednesday Group is a self-organizing group of about 25 talented local artists who meet on Wednesdays to paint en plein air at locations throughout the East End. Inspired by the landscapes, seascapes and historic neighborhoods on the North and South Forks, the group shows their work at local galleries and has received acclaim over the 12 years since its inception.
